What kind of elements react to form ionic compounds?

Ionic compounds generally form between elements that are metals and elements that are nonmetals. For example, the metal calcium (Ca) and the nonmetal chlorine (Cl) form the ionic compound calcium chloride (CaCl2).

Can lithium and magnesium form an ionic bond?

Lithium and magnesium are Group 1 and Group 2 elements respectively. Elements of these groups are highly ionic, and I’ve never heard of them forming significantly covalent _inorganic_ compounds. Yet these elements form a variety of organometallic compounds ($\ce{PhLi}$, the whole family of Grignard reagents, etc).

Is sucrose acid ionic or covalent?

Sucrose is a covalent compound. Whether a compound is ionic or covalent depends on the relative attraction the compound’s atoms have for electrons. Sucrose is composed of carbon, hydrogen and oxygen, all of which have similar enough attractions for electrons to form covalent bonds with each other.

When are ionic equations the most important?

One of the most useful applications of the concept of principal species is in writing net ionic equations. These are equations that focus on the principal substances and ions involved in a reaction–the principal species–ignoring those spectator ions that really don’t get involved.

How are names written for ionic compounds?

For binary ionic compounds (ionic compounds that contain only two types of elements), the compounds are named by writing the name of the cation first followed by the name of the anion. For example, KCl, an ionic compound that contains K+ and Cl- ions, is named potassium chloride.
